Model Overview

The model uses the LED (Longformer-Encoder-Decoder) architecture, specifically designed for generating concise and accurate abstracts from PubMed biomedical papers.

Model Features

Biomedical Domain Optimization
Specifically trained and optimized for PubMed biomedical literature
Long Text Processing Capability
Based on the LED architecture, suitable for long document abstract generation
High-Quality Abstracts
Performs exceptionally well on PubMed datasets, achieving a ROUGE-1 score of 45.861
